RMCs campus is 1500 (1000 belong to students) machines in 40+ buildings
wired with fiber and copper. There is 1 main distribution point where the
servers and routers are. When I took over a year ago the entire campus was
3Com. A 3Com layer3 switch for routing and 3Com layer 2 switches and hubs
for distribution. I added a low cost 3Com layer3 switch to separate the
admin network from the residential network but I am kind of unhappy with it.
I am looking for a good modular layer 3 & 4 switch with GB copper and
100BaseFX fiber capability. So far I have spec'd out the HP Procurve 5300
series and as soon as I have 10 or 12 hours to figure out all the parts, I
want to look into Cisco's offerings. I think Cisco will be far more
expensive than I can afford though. I was wondering if anyone can share
experience with HP's gear and their service. I am also hoping that I can get
some recommendations on other manufacturers who have this type of gear. The
only ones I know of in this area are 3Com, HP and Cisco but I know there
must be others. Thanks!
